Responsibilities
- Prepare and review journal entries and account reconciliations for month-end close in compliance with the monthly close deadlines. Ensure all transactions are accounted for in accordance with US GAAP.
- Analyze and prepare journal entries for capitalized labor costs related to internally developed software and network construction costs, and record interdepartmental non-capitalized labor cost allocations.
- Review propriety of project costs that have been capitalized and analyze use tax.
- Process project and fixed asset additions, adjustments, cost transfers, disposals, and impairments.
- Review contracts and prepare customer invoices and revenue recognition schedules in accordance with ASC 606, Revenue from Contracts with Customers.
- Prepare recurring and adjusting journal entries for revenues and cost accruals.
- Prepare balance sheet account reconciliations including analysis of account changes.
- Work closely with multiple departments to ensure all transactions are accounted for timely and in accordance with US GAAP.
- Complete audit requests and inquiries from external auditors and other third parties.
- Drive process improvements and identify opportunities for cost savings.
- Assist with the implementation and maintenance of internal controls and policies and procedures to support the rapid growth and expansion of the company.
- Perform ad hoc analysis and assist with special projects.
